引言阿里云作为国内领先的云服务提供商,其提供的HTTPD环境为PHP应用程序的运行提供了稳定的平台。本文将详细介绍如何在阿里云的HTTPD环境下配置PHP,帮助您高效搭建PHP环境,轻松上手。一、准备...
阿里云作为国内领先的云服务提供商,其提供的HTTPD环境为PHP应用程序的运行提供了稳定的平台。本文将详细介绍如何在阿里云的HTTPD环境下配置PHP,帮助您高效搭建PHP环境,轻松上手。
在开始配置之前,请确保您已经:
首先,您需要选择一个适合您需求的PHP版本。阿里云官方推荐使用PHP 7.x系列,因为其性能更优。
您可以从PHP官网下载PHP安装包。以下是一个示例命令,用于下载PHP 7.4版本的安装包:
wget https://php.net/distributions/php-7.4.28.tar.gz将下载的安装包解压到您的服务器上:
tar -zxvf php-7.4.28.tar.gzcd php-7.4.28使用以下命令配置PHP:
./configure --prefix=/usr/local/php --with-apache=/usr/local/apache2这里的--with-apache=/usr/local/apache2表示将PHP与Apache HTTP服务器进行集成。
make && make install在Apache的配置目录下创建一个名为php.conf的文件:
touch /usr/local/apache2/conf/php.conf将以下内容添加到php.conf文件中:
LoadModule php7_module modules/libphp7.so
<IfModule mod_php7.c> AddType application/x-httpd-php .php AddType application/x-httpd-php-source .phps PHPIniDir "/usr/local/php"
</IfModule>sudo systemctl restart httpd在Apache的根目录下创建一个名为info.php的文件,并添加以下内容:
<?php
phpinfo();
?>在浏览器中访问http://您的公网IP/info.php,如果看到PHP的信息页面,则表示PHP环境配置成功。
通过以上步骤,您已经成功在阿里云的HTTPD环境下配置了PHP环境。接下来,您可以根据自己的需求安装和配置其他PHP扩展和应用程序。祝您搭建PHP环境顺利!